Didn't they used to be called a "show of presents"? Happened over two evenings, the first for Grannies and Aunties and the second for pals and workmates. Tea and sandwiches followed a small sherry. On the second night the bride to be was dressed up and taken around the local streets armed with a chamber pot to collect donations in exchange for kisses from the local guys - unless, of course, you lived in a posh area! Ah, for the good old days when "hen nights" didn't cost an arm and a leg......... and a hangover!!!!
